The Bishop Amat Lancers will take on the Sultana Sultans at 3:30 p.m. on Saturday. Bishop Amat will be looking to extend their current 19-game winning streak.
Bishop Amat is on a roll after a high-stakes playoff matchup on Saturday. Their defense stepped up to hand El Segundo a 5-0 shutout. The Lancers might be getting used to big wins seeing as the team has won 13 matches by three goals or more this season.
They hit El Segundo with a four-pronged attack, as the team got scores from Matthew Ibarra (2), Sebastian Saucedo, Rosario DeAgapito, and Jancarlo Hernandez.
Bonita typically has all the answers at home, but on Saturday Sultana proved too difficult a challenge. They had just enough and edged out the Bearcats 1-0. The victory was familiar territory for the Sultans, who have now won seven contests in a row.
Bishop Amat pushed their record up to 27-2 with the win, which was their 14th straight at home. The wins came thanks in part to their offensive performance across that stretch, as they scored 55 goals over those 14 games. As for Sultana, their victory bumped their record up to 19-3.
